In den WarenkorbHardcover. Zustand: Good Plus. Third Impression. Lieutenant Arnold Hodson was a game hunter and police officer in the Bechuanaland Protectorate. Not only was he successful as a hunter but as a police officer he attained singular credit. His work on the German border during the Herrero War won the appreciation of the Germans and special commendation of both the Foreign and the Colonial Office. 359pp with four maps, three of which folding and 85 black and white illustrations.

A scarce first edition educational work detailing the language of the Oromo people of Ethiopia, constructed by two civil servants based in Ethiopia. The first edition of this scarce guide to the language and grammar of the Oromo peopleThe Oromo are a Cushitic ethnic group and nation native to the Oromia region of Ethiopia and Kenya, who speak the Oromo language as their mother tongue. They are the largest ethnic group in Ethiopia and currently represent 34.5% of Ethiopia's population.Colonial era documents written by other ethnic groups refer to these people as the Galla, which has now developed derogatory connotations.Chapters explore the phonetic alphabet, nouns, case expression, conditional sentences, pronouns, and many other aspects of the Oromo language. The vanishingly scarce, first edition, first impression of Arnold Hodson's fascinating account of his time exploring the Kalahari Desert, illustrated with folding maps and plates. The first edition, first impression.Vanishingly scarce. Bound in the publisher's pictorial cloth. A fascinating travel account presenting the author's travels across the arid Kalahari Desert, including commission trips and diplomatic missions, camp life, hunting and lion-hunting. Written by Arnold W. Hodson, a colonial administrator who served as Governor of Sierra Leone and the Gold Coast.
